I am planning on moving to Thailand for 6 months. I want to get a apartment in Bangkok. What are my Visa Options? Isnt there some kind of 6mo travel visa? Is there a Thai counsulate in Canada? Does anybody have any tips on living in bangkok? I am planning on leaving in October.

A 2 entry tourist visa would give you about six months without getting a new visa. You get sixty days per entry that can be extended for 30 days. After that 90 days you would need to make a border run to use the 2nd entry. You can also get a 3 entry that would give you almost 9 months.

See this webpage from the embassy in Ottawa for a list of conulates in Canada. http://www.magma.ca/~thaiott/visa3.htm

Best would be to contact any of them but Ottawa or Vancouver. These two are are goverment consulates and are known to give poor service. The others are honorary consulates which are much better.

Don't apply for your visa until about 2 weeks before you leave because the use before date starts on the date of issue.
